Objectives

The primary objective of this study is to demonstrate the **non-inferiority** in terms of short-term response of oral **dexamethasone** administered at 40 mg on days 1 to 4 compared to intravenous immunoglobulin (IVIg) given at 1 g/kg on days 1 and 2, in combination with **prednisone** (1 mg/kg per day for 3 weeks) in adult patients with **immune thrombocytopenia** (ITP) with mild to severe bleeding manifestations. This is clinically relevant as it aims to establish an effective and potentially more convenient treatment regimen for ITP, which could improve patient compliance and outcomes.

Secondary objectives include:

  • To compare the initial rate of complete response (CR) in the two arms and the delay to obtain a CR.
  • To compare the duration of the response in the two arms.
  • To assess the acceptability and feasibility of the protocol by comparing the proportion of early treatment switches (before day 5) across arms.
  • To estimate the interaction between treatment effect and the severity/risk of bleeding.
  • To compare the initial response on bleeding manifestations in both arms.
  • To compare the duration of hospital stay in the two arms.
  • To compare the efficacy (overall response rate) at Day 28 and 6 months in the two arms.
  • To compare the safety profile in the two arms.
  • To estimate the incremental (decremental) cost-effectiveness of dexamethasone versus IVIg at 6 months, given the non-inferiority design, with the hypothesis that dexamethasone is cheaper and non-inferior in cost-effectiveness compared to IVIg.
  • To assess whether the presence of anti-platelet antibodies is associated with the outcome (chronic or cured) at 6 months in the two arms.

Participants

The clinical trial involves **adult patients** diagnosed with **immune thrombocytopenia (ITP)**, characterized by mild to severe bleeding manifestations. The study population includes both male and female participants, aged between 18 and 80 years. Participants are required to have a platelet count of ≤ 20 x 109/L and exhibit any cutaneous and/or mucosal bleeding manifestations. The trial does not specify the total number of participants, as this information was not provided by the sponsor. The selection criteria include individuals affiliated with a social security regime and those who have provided written consent. The trial population encompasses a vulnerable group, and the study does not impose specific lifestyle considerations such as diet or physical activity. The inclusion criteria allow for both newly diagnosed and relapsed cases of ITP, ensuring a diverse representation of the disease's progression.

Plans and Procedures

The clinical trial is designed to evaluate the **non-inferiority** of oral **dexamethasone** compared to intravenous **immunoglobulin** (IVIg) in combination with **prednisone** for adult patients with **immune thrombocytopenia** (ITP) exhibiting mild to severe bleeding manifestations. This is a randomized, multicenter trial with a double-blind, controlled design. The trial is expected to last approximately 18 months, with an estimated recruitment start date of April 7, 2022, and an estimated end date of October 7, 2025.

Participants will undergo a series of study visits, beginning with an inclusion (screening) visit to confirm eligibility based on criteria such as age (18-80 years), diagnosis of ITP, platelet count ≤ 20 x 109/L, and the presence of bleeding manifestations. Following the screening, eligible participants will be randomized into one of the treatment arms. The trial involves a treatment period where participants receive either oral dexamethasone at 40 mg on days 1 to 4 or IVIg at 1 g/kg on days 1 and 2, combined with prednisone at 1 mg/kg per day for 3 weeks.

Follow-up visits will be conducted to monitor the time to achieve an initial response, defined as a platelet count ≥ 30 x 109/L with at least a doubling of the baseline value, and to assess the absence of new bleeding and the use of other ITP-directed therapies. Secondary endpoints include the time to achieve a complete response, duration of overall response, and the number of new bleeding manifestations. The end-of-study visit will occur at 6 months, where the rates of response and complete response, as well as adverse events, will be evaluated.

Participant involvement is expected to last for the duration of the treatment and follow-up period, totaling approximately 6 months. Conditions that may lead to early termination from the study include the occurrence of severe adverse events, withdrawal of consent, or the need for alternative ITP-directed therapies not included in the treatment arm. Treatment

The clinical trial involves the administration of **Neofordex 40 mg tablets**, which contain the active substance **dexamethasone**. This medication is provided in tablet form and is administered orally. The dosing regimen for dexamethasone is 40 mg per day, given on days 1 to 4 of the treatment cycle. The maximum total dose over the treatment period is 320 mg, with a maximum treatment duration of 8 days. Dexamethasone is a chemical substance classified under the ATC code H02AB02 and is used as a test treatment in this study.

Another treatment used in the trial is **prednisone**, which is administered in conjunction with intravenous immunoglobulin (IVIg). Prednisone is given orally at a dosage of 1 mg/kg per day for a duration of 3 weeks, with a maximum total dose of 21 mg/kg. Prednisone is a chemical substance, and its administration is intended to complement the effects of IVIg in the treatment of immune thrombocytopenia (ITP). The ATC code for prednisone is H02AB07.

The study also includes the use of **human normal immunoglobulin (IV)**, administered intravenously. The dosing schedule for IVIg is 1 g/kg on days 1 and 2, with a maximum total dose of 2000 mg/kg over the treatment period. This treatment is classified under the ATC code J06BA02 and is derived from a structurally diverse substance, specifically blood-derived immunoglobulins. IVIg serves as a comparator treatment in the trial, aiming to evaluate its efficacy in combination with prednisone against the test treatment of high-dose dexamethasone.

Efficacy

Efficacy in the clinical trial will be assessed using both primary and secondary endpoints. The primary endpoint is the time to achieve an initial response (R) within 5 days, defined as a platelet count of at least 30 x 109/L with at least a doubling of the baseline value, in the absence of new bleeding and without the use of any other immune thrombocytopenia (ITP) directed therapies. Secondary endpoints include the time to achieve an initial complete response (CR), defined by a platelet count greater than 100 x 109/L, and the duration of overall response from Day 1 to the end of the study (6 months). Additional secondary endpoints involve the proportion of early treatment switches, the number of new bleeding manifestations, rates of response and complete response at 28 days and 6 months, and the number of days of hospitalization.

Bleeding manifestations will be assessed using the score reported by Khellaf et al. The trial will also evaluate the number of adverse events, the incremental cost-effectiveness ratio expressed in cost per responder at 6 months, and the comparison of the number of responders and outcomes at 6 months in patients with positive and negative anti-platelet antibodies. Efficacy parameters will be collected and analyzed at specified time points, including Day 1, Day 5, Day 28, and at 6 months, to ensure comprehensive assessment of treatment effects in both trial arms.

Inclusion and Exclusion Criteria

check_circle

Inclusion Criteria

  • Age ≥ 18 years ≤ 80 years
  • Diagnosis of ITP whatever the duration of the disease (newly diagnosed or relapsed) according to the standard definition
  • Platelet count ≤ 20 x 109/L
  • Any cutaneous and/or any mucosal bleeding manifestations
  • Affiliated to a social security regime
  • Written consent from patient
cancel

Exclusion Criteria

  • Symptomatic COVID-19 disease
  • Life-threatening bleeding defined as Intracranial hemorrhage and/or active organ bleeding (GI tract, urinary tract or menorrhagia with at least a 2 g/dl decrease of hemoglobin value from baseline).
  • Ongoing anticoagulation treatment (Therapeutic Low molecular weight heparins (LMWHs), direct oral anticoagulants (DOACs) and vitamin K antagonists (VKAs))
  • Previous non-response to IVIg or DEX
  • Treatment with prednisone (1 mg/kg per day) for more than 3 days
  • Any contraindications to the prescribed Ig IV or prednisone patent medicine and to Neofordex®
  • Ongoing severe infection
  • Severe Renal insufficiency (DFG < 45 ml.min.1.73m2)
  • Severe Cardiac insufficiency (FEVG < 30 %)
  • Ongoing viral infection (uncontrolled HIV, Viral hepatitis, herpes, varicella, zona)
  • Uncontrolled diabetes (Acido-cetosis)
  • Psychotic state not yet controlled by treatment
  • Inability or refusal to understand or refusal to sign the informed consent from study participation
  • Persons deprived of their liberty by judicial or administrative decision
  • Persons under legal protection (guardianship, curatorship)
  • Pregnant or breastfeeding woman or ineffective contraception
  • Participation in another interventional study involving human participants or being in the exclusion period at the end of a previous study involving human participants
